Abscess Incision and Drainage
Minor surgical treatment to relieve painful abscesses by safely draining infection under local anaesthetic. Helps reduce pain, swelling and supports faster healing.
Diabetic Foot Care
Specialist care for diabetic foot ulcers, infections and circulation problems. Includes wound assessment, debridement and management to prevent complications.
Endovenous Laser Ablation (EVLA)
Minimally invasive laser treatment for varicose veins. Seals faulty veins under ultrasound guidance with quick recovery and high success rates.
Foam Sclerotherapy
Ultrasound-guided injection treatment for varicose veins. Improves symptoms such as aching and swelling without surgery.
Ultrasound Vascular Doppler
Non-invasive scan to assess blood flow in arteries and veins. Used to diagnose circulation problems and guide treatment decisions.

What symptoms should I see a vascular specialist for?
You should consider a consultation if you have varicose veins, leg pain when walking, swollen legs or ankles, poor circulation, non-healing wounds, diabetic foot problems, painful abscesses, or persistent skin infections. Early assessment can help prevent complications and guide timely treatment.
Will I need surgery for my condition?
Not always. Many vascular and soft tissue conditions can be treated without surgery. Depending on your diagnosis, your specialist may recommend conservative management, minimally invasive procedures, or surgery if it offers the best long-term outcome.
What happens during my first consultation?
Your appointment includes a detailed discussion about your symptoms, medical history, and a clinical examination. If required, further investigations such as a vascular Doppler ultrasound may be recommended to help confirm the diagnosis and plan your treatment.
What is a vascular Doppler ultrasound and why might I need one?
A vascular Doppler ultrasound is a painless, non-invasive scan that measures blood flow through your arteries and veins. It helps diagnose circulation problems, varicose veins, venous insufficiency, and other vascular conditions, allowing your specialist to recommend the most appropriate treatment.
How is EVLA different from foam sclerotherapy?
Both treatments are used to treat varicose veins but are suitable for different situations. EVLA uses laser energy to seal larger faulty veins, while foam sclerotherapy uses ultrasound-guided injections to treat smaller or residual veins. Your consultant will recommend the most suitable option based on your vein assessment.
Can diabetic foot problems be treated before they become serious?
Yes. Early assessment is important for diabetic foot ulcers, infections, and circulation problems. Prompt treatment can reduce the risk of complications, improve healing, and help protect long-term foot health.
